Attentive, dynamic, and future-oriented, the cantonal administration and its institutions are at the service of the population.Who are we?The Cantonal Tax Service (SCC) carries out the assessment and collection of cantonal taxes and direct federal tax for individuals and legal entities. For the latter, it also collects church tax. The SCC assumes, on a contractual basis for numerous municipalities and parishes, the collection of their taxes.Why join us?We rely on the complementarity of skills and the variety of perspectives because it is the diversity of backgrounds and profiles that makes the strength of the Canton of Fribourg.
